Joint Committee on Environment and Climate Action to resume pre-legislative scrutiny General Scheme of Circular Economy Bill

13 Oct 2021, 17:15

The Joint Committee on Environment and Climate Action will meet tomorrow, Thursday, 14 October, to resume pre-legislative scrutiny of the General Scheme of the Circular Economy Bill.

The meeting at 5.30pm in Committee Room 1 of Leinster House will hear from Jean-Pierre Schweitzer of the European Environmental Bureau, and Mindy O’Brien, Chief Executive of Voice Ireland.

Committee Cathaoirleach Deputy Brian Leddin said: “The Circular Economy Bill 2021 is a key step in the transition to an economy where waste and resource use can be minimised and proposes the necessary legislative basis for an alternative to the existing model of production and consumption, which is economically and environmentally unsustainable.

“Last week the Committee was briefed on the Heads of the Bill by officials from the Department of Environment, Climate and Communications. We know look forward to discussing this legislation with Mr Schweitzer and Ms O’Brien.”

The Joint Committee on Environment and Climate Action has 14 Members, nine from the Dáil and five from the Seanad.
